Cmd-Q went straight through to teardown, killing the backend mid-tool-call — the turn is gone and whatever the agent was part-way through writing stays part-way written, with nothing on screen to warn about it. Renderers now report which chats are mid-turn; before-quit merges the reports and asks, naming them, defaulting to Keep Running. Update, swap, and uninstall relaunches skip the prompt: those are the app replacing itself, and a modal there would strand the detached script waiting on a PID that never exits.
